Job Description
The Ohio Department of Health is seeking an Administrative Professional 4 to perform non-routine administrative tasks and provide secretarial support to the Bureau of Infectious Diseases. The role involves monitoring and tracking requests, responding to correspondence, and maintaining fiscal records, among other responsibilities.

Requirements

  • Monitor, organize and track requests sent to the Bureau Chief
  • Respond to correspondence
  • Review and summarize fiscal, operational, and personnel reports
  • Research and prepare data for budget inclusion
  • Monitor spending and maintain fiscal records
  • Represent bureau or agency on inter-divisional task forces or committees
  • Coordinate acquisition and maintenance of bureau office equipment
  • Track progress of Bureau initiatives and coordinate activity to ensure on-time completion
  • Maintain calendar and/or make travel arrangements for supervisor
  • Take and transcribe dictation and/or minutes of meetings
  • Prepare records retention and disposal schedules and arrange record transfers
